Abstract
Because of the utmost significance of this heterocyclic system and their diverse pharmacological properties, many strategies for the synthesis of substituted coumarins have been developed. 3 Classical routes 4 to coumarins incorporate Pechmann, Knoevenagel, Perkin, Reformatsky and Wittig condensation reactions. However, most of these methods suffer from expensive catalyst, harsh reaction conditions, multistep synthesis or low chemical yield.
